Mahindra Invests Rs. 15,000 Crore on its Upcoming Manufacturing Facility

Mahindra Group has announced an enormous 15,000 crore investment plan to put up its biggest integrated manufacturing facility in Maharashtra. At an event in Vidarbha (Maharashtra), the company unveiled its ambitious project promising to transform the region into a global automotive powerhouse. The future plant, which is planned to start operations in 2028, is part of “Make in India of the World” strategy of Mahindra.
Mahindra Nagpur Mega-Plant
The next plant at Nagpur will be the largest manufacturing presence of Mahindra, occupying a large 1,500 acres of land in Vidarbha.
Multi-Powertrain Flexibility
The Nagpur hub will be ultimate in terms of adaptability. It will be in a position to manufacture vehicles in various powertrains like Internal combustion Engines (ICE), Electric Vehicles (EVs), and new-propulsion technologies. This enables Mahindra to shift-based production according to the changing market needs. The plant, once fully operational, will have a capacity of producing more than 5 lakh vehicles annually.
Next-Gen NUiQ Architecture
The major highlight is the assistance of the NUiQ architecture, a next-generation platform developed by Mahindra which is a “multi-energy platform”. This high-tech platform will support a new portfolio of global SUVs, including Vision S, Vision X and Vision T concepts.
Farm Equipment Manufacturing
Apart from the manufacturing of passenger vehicles, the future plant will also focus on farm equipment. This Nagpur site will house a dedicated production of Tractors, aiming to become world’s largest tractor manufacturer. The integrated unit is expected to produce 1 Lakh units annually.
Regional Supplier Ecosystem
The investment extends beyond Nagpur, creating a comprehensive industrial network across Maharashtra. Two major supplier regions are allocated currently:
Sambhajinagar Supplier Park: Mahindra is building its 150-acre supplier park in Sambhajinagar. The park will work as a major distributing unit, further selling products to different locations in the country. This will improve localization and reduce costs.
Igatpuri-Nashik Expansion: Part of the same plan, Mahindra plans to acquire in the Igatpuri-Nashik region to scale up engine production.
The auto giant currently owns six major manufacturing plants all over India. Adding this one will boost the company’s presence in more remote parts of the country.
